Attributes

event
object
lago_subscription_id
string
required

Unique identifier assigned to the subscription within the Lago application. This ID is exclusively created by Lago and serves as a unique identifier for the subscription’s record within the Lago system.

transaction_id
string
required

This field represents a unique identifier for the event. It is crucial for ensuring idempotency, meaning that each event can be uniquely identified and processed without causing any unintended side effects.

external_customer_id (deprecated)
string

The customer external unique identifier (provided by your own application). This field is optional if you send the external_subscription_id, targeting a specific subscription.

This field is deprecated and is no longer supported or maintained. Please use the external_subscription_id instead.
external_subscription_id
string
required

The unique identifier of the subscription within your application. It is a mandatory field when the customer possesses multiple subscriptions or when the external_customer_id is not provided.

code
string
required

The code that identifies a targeted billable metric. It is essential that this code matches the code property of one of your active billable metrics. If the provided code does not correspond to any active billable metric, it will be ignored during the process.

timestamp
integer

This field captures the Unix timestamp in seconds indicating the occurrence of the event in Coordinated Universal Time (UTC). If this timestamp is not provided, the API will automatically set it to the time of event reception.
